What you'll be doing
1. The maintenance, erection, and removal of street lighting, signs, and related equipment, with careful attention to buried services and overhead cables.
2. The excavation and reinstatement of coated and other surface materials.
3. Driving vehicles and operating ancillary plant (such as hoists or lorry loaders), including routine vehicle and plant checks, maintenance, and cleaning.
